Retired Soviet aircraft carrier to remain China theme park after auction

AGENCE FRANCE-PRESSE,

BEIJING: The retired Soviet aircraft carrier Minsk, now a popular Chinese tourist attraction, will remain a military theme park after a new owner bought it at an auction, state media reported Thursday.

CITIC Shenzhen Group, an investment company, bought the 34-year-old vessel for 128.3 million yuan (16 million dollars) at an auction Wednesday at Minsk's home, the south Chinese city of Shenzhen, the Xinhua news agency said.

CITIC Shenzhen Group will invest further in developing the floating theme park while maintaining its military style, the group's general manager, Guo Zhirong, told Xinhua.

The aircraft carrier was put up for auction earlier this year after its former owner Minsk World Industries Co. went bankrupt.

Once the pride of the Soviet Union, the Minsk was sold for scrap to a South Korean company in the 1990s, before being passed on to Minsk World Industries Co.

Once it had been renovated and equipped with restaurants and beauty salons, it became a fairly successful tourist attraction.

It recorded a total of 33,000 visitors during the Lunar New Year holiday early this year, according to Xinhua.
